Quoting msquared (msquared@digitalwizards.com.au):
> On Thu, Feb 01, 2001 at 01:32:45AM -0500, Mike Heins wrote:
>
> > * Set "NoAbsolute Yes" in interchange.cfg, it prevents [file /some/dir]
> > or [include /some/rogue/file] from being used. NOTE: This is the
> > default starting in IC 4.7.x.
>
> Does this option also prevent ".." in relative pathnames?
Of course.
